Storage
Storage allows you to see the storage devices attached to your FreedomBox and their disk space usage.
FreedomBox can automatically detect and mount removable media like USB flash drives. They are listed under the Removable Devices section along with an option to eject them.
If there is some free space left after the root partition, the option to expand the root partition is also available. This is typically not shown, since expanding the root partition happens automatically when the FreedomBox starts up for the first time.
Advanced Storage Operations
Cockpit provides many advanced storage features over those offered by FreedomBox. Both FreedomBox and Cockpit operate over Udisks2 storage daemon and are hence compatible with each other. Some of the functions provided by Cockpit include:
- Format a disk or partition with a fresh filesystem
- Add, remove partitions or wipe the partition table
- Create and unlock encrypted file systems
- Create and manage RAID devices
